View | Details | Raw Unified | Return to bug 215063
Collapse All | Expand All

(-)net/freeswitch/Makefile (-8 / +11 lines)
Lines 2-9 Link Here
2
# $FreeBSD$
2
# $FreeBSD$
3
3
4
PORTNAME=	freeswitch
4
PORTNAME=	freeswitch
5
PORTVERSION=	1.6.8
5
PORTVERSION=	1.6.13
6
PORTREVISION=	2
7
CATEGORIES=	net
6
CATEGORIES=	net
8
MASTER_SITES=	http://files.freeswitch.org/releases/freeswitch/ \
7
MASTER_SITES=	http://files.freeswitch.org/releases/freeswitch/ \
9
		http://files.freeswitch.org/releases/sounds/:sounds
8
		http://files.freeswitch.org/releases/sounds/:sounds
Lines 17-35 Link Here
17
LIB_DEPENDS=	libsqlite3.so:databases/sqlite3 \
16
LIB_DEPENDS=	libsqlite3.so:databases/sqlite3 \
18
		libcurl.so:ftp/curl \
17
		libcurl.so:ftp/curl \
19
		libpcre.so:devel/pcre \
18
		libpcre.so:devel/pcre \
19
		libspeexdsp.so:audio/speexdsp \
20
		libspeex.so:audio/speex \
20
		libspeex.so:audio/speex \
21
		libldns.so:dns/ldns \
21
		libldns.so:dns/ldns \
22
		libopus.so:audio/opus \
22
		libopus.so:audio/opus \
23
		libsndfile.so:audio/libsndfile
23
		libsndfile.so:audio/libsndfile \
24
		libfreetype.so:print/freetype2 \
25
		libpng16.so:graphics/png \
26
		libjbig.so:graphics/jbigkit
24
27
25
CONFLICTS_BUILD=	xmlrpc-c-*
28
CONFLICTS_BUILD=	xmlrpc-c-*
26
29
27
BROKEN=			unfetchable (checksum mismatch) and attempts to strip libfreeswitch.a\
28
			(returns file format not recognized)
29
BROKEN_FreeBSD_9=	Fails in configure due to compiler issues
30
BROKEN_FreeBSD_9=	Fails in configure due to compiler issues
30
ONLY_FOR_ARCHS=	amd64
31
ONLY_FOR_ARCHS=	amd64
31
32
32
USES=		gmake jpeg pkgconfig lua perl5 libtool shebangfix tar:xz
33
USES=		gmake jpeg pkgconfig lua perl5 libtool shebangfix tar:xz iconv libedit ssl
33
USE_LDCONFIG=	yes
34
USE_LDCONFIG=	yes
34
35
35
ALL_MODULES_DESC=	Build all modules
36
ALL_MODULES_DESC=	Build all modules
Lines 50-55 Link Here
50
NO_OPTIONS_SORT=	yes
51
NO_OPTIONS_SORT=	yes
51
OPTIONS_SUB=		yes
52
OPTIONS_SUB=		yes
52
53
54
ALL_MODULES_CONFLICTS_BUILD+=	apr
53
ALL_MODULES_EXTRA_PATCHES=	${FILESDIR}/extrapatch-modules.conf
55
ALL_MODULES_EXTRA_PATCHES=	${FILESDIR}/extrapatch-modules.conf
54
56
55
GNU_CONFIGURE=		yes
57
GNU_CONFIGURE=		yes
Lines 70-80 Link Here
70
.include <bsd.port.options.mk>
72
.include <bsd.port.options.mk>
71
73
72
.if ${PORT_OPTIONS:MALL_MODULES}
74
.if ${PORT_OPTIONS:MALL_MODULES}
75
USE_XORG=	x11
73
BUILD_DEPENDS+=	${LOCALBASE}/include/ladspa.h:audio/ladspa \
76
BUILD_DEPENDS+=	${LOCALBASE}/include/ladspa.h:audio/ladspa \
74
		${LOCALBASE}/bin/aclocal:devel/automake
77
		${LOCALBASE}/bin/aclocal:devel/automake
75
RUN_DEPENDS+=	${LOCALBASE}/include/ladspa.h:audio/ladspa
78
RUN_DEPENDS+=	${LOCALBASE}/include/ladspa.h:audio/ladspa
76
LIB_DEPENDS+=	libavformat.so:multimedia/ffmpeg \
79
LIB_DEPENDS+=	libavformat.so:multimedia/ffmpeg \
77
		libopencv_legacy.so:graphics/opencv2 \
80
		libopencv_gpu.so:graphics/opencv2 \
81
		libopencv_core.so:graphics/opencv2-core \
78
		libhiredis.so:databases/hiredis \
82
		libhiredis.so:databases/hiredis \
79
		libmemcached.so:databases/libmemcached \
83
		libmemcached.so:databases/libmemcached \
80
		libSoundTouch.so:audio/soundtouch \
84
		libSoundTouch.so:audio/soundtouch \
Lines 88-94 Link Here
88
		libvlc.so:multimedia/vlc \
92
		libvlc.so:multimedia/vlc \
89
		libyaml.so:textproc/libyaml
93
		libyaml.so:textproc/libyaml
90
USE_OPENLDAP=	yes
94
USE_OPENLDAP=	yes
91
USE_OPENSSL=	yes
92
.if ${PORT_OPTIONS:MX11}
95
.if ${PORT_OPTIONS:MX11}
93
LIB_DEPENDS+=	libMagickWand-6.so:graphics/ImageMagick
96
LIB_DEPENDS+=	libMagickWand-6.so:graphics/ImageMagick
94
.else
97
.else
(-)net/freeswitch/distinfo (-2 / +3 lines)
Lines 1-5 Link Here
1
SHA256 (freeswitch-1.6.8.tar.xz) = a9834667c0afc164631611b4862acd6411e4e6ddb706e4af4b51eab4adbe4fc1
1
TIMESTAMP = 1480871875
2
SIZE (freeswitch-1.6.8.tar.xz) = 33460304
2
SHA256 (freeswitch-1.6.13.tar.xz) = 64a8a14fc5df92893d956868f144042891cc3e2d096bbf56241fec706635a8b7
3
SIZE (freeswitch-1.6.13.tar.xz) = 33568084
3
SHA256 (freeswitch-sounds-music-8000-1.0.51.tar.gz) = 7556d3eb314be939992a3f73c0d7754e44b36859d670e0b42d4cff7f9c0789a9
4
SHA256 (freeswitch-sounds-music-8000-1.0.51.tar.gz) = 7556d3eb314be939992a3f73c0d7754e44b36859d670e0b42d4cff7f9c0789a9
4
SIZE (freeswitch-sounds-music-8000-1.0.51.tar.gz) = 14619493
5
SIZE (freeswitch-sounds-music-8000-1.0.51.tar.gz) = 14619493
5
SHA256 (freeswitch-sounds-en-us-callie-8000-1.0.51.tar.gz) = e48a63bd69e6253d294ce43a941d603b02467feb5d92ee57a536ccc5f849a4a8
6
SHA256 (freeswitch-sounds-en-us-callie-8000-1.0.51.tar.gz) = e48a63bd69e6253d294ce43a941d603b02467feb5d92ee57a536ccc5f849a4a8
(-)net/freeswitch/files/extrapatch-modules.conf (-6 / +7 lines)
Lines 1-17 Link Here
1
--- modules.conf.orig	2016-05-05 16:42:20.000000000 -0400
1
--- modules.conf.orig	2016-08-25 12:35:35 UTC
2
+++ modules.conf	2016-05-06 16:42:38.276496730 -0400
2
+++ modules.conf
3
@@ -1,161 +1,161 @@
3
@@ -1,162 +1,162 @@
4
-#applications/mod_abstraction
4
-#applications/mod_abstraction
5
-#applications/mod_av
5
-#applications/mod_av
6
-#applications/mod_avmd
6
-#applications/mod_avmd
7
+applications/mod_abstraction
8
+applications/mod_av
9
+applications/mod_avmd
10
-#applications/mod_bert
7
-#applications/mod_bert
11
-#applications/mod_blacklist
8
-#applications/mod_blacklist
12
-#applications/mod_callcenter
9
-#applications/mod_callcenter
13
-#applications/mod_cidlookup
10
-#applications/mod_cidlookup
14
-#applications/mod_cluechoo
11
-#applications/mod_cluechoo
12
+applications/mod_abstraction
13
+applications/mod_av
14
+applications/mod_avmd
15
+applications/mod_bert
15
+applications/mod_bert
16
+applications/mod_blacklist
16
+applications/mod_blacklist
17
+applications/mod_callcenter
17
+applications/mod_callcenter
Lines 69-74 Link Here
69
+applications/mod_redis
69
+applications/mod_redis
70
+applications/mod_rss
70
+applications/mod_rss
71
 applications/mod_sms
71
 applications/mod_sms
72
 #applications/mod_sms_flowroute
72
-#applications/mod_snapshot
73
-#applications/mod_snapshot
73
-#applications/mod_snom
74
-#applications/mod_snom
74
-#applications/mod_sonar
75
-#applications/mod_sonar
(-)net/freeswitch/files/patch-build_config_ltmain.sh (+15 lines)
Line 0 Link Here
1
--- build/config/ltmain.sh.orig	2016-08-25 12:36:38 UTC
2
+++ build/config/ltmain.sh
3
@@ -2260,9 +2260,9 @@ func_mode_install ()
4
 
5
       func_show_eval "$install_prog \$file \$oldlib" 'exit $?'
6
 
7
-      if test -n "$stripme" && test -n "$old_striplib"; then
8
-	func_show_eval "$old_striplib $oldlib" 'exit $?'
9
-      fi
10
+#      if test -n "$stripme" && test -n "$old_striplib"; then
11
+#	func_show_eval "$old_striplib $oldlib" 'exit $?'
12
+#      fi
13
 
14
       # Do each command in the postinstall commands.
15
       func_execute_cmds "$old_postinstall_cmds" 'exit $?'
(-)net/freeswitch/files/patch-configure (-11 lines)
Lines 1-11 Link Here
1
--- configure.orig	2016-05-18 22:49:18.753911000 +0000
2
+++ configure	2016-05-18 22:49:38.480978000 +0000
3
@@ -20062,7 +20062,7 @@
4
 fi
5
 
6
 
7
-for luaversion in lua5.2 lua-5.2 lua5.1 lua-5.1 lua; do
8
+for luaversion in lua5.3 lua-5.3 lua5.2 lua-5.2 lua5.1 lua-5.1 lua; do
9
 
10
   succeeded=no
11
 
(-)net/freeswitch/files/patch-src_mod_applications_mod__avmd_avmd__fast__acosf.c (-12 lines)
Lines 1-12 Link Here
1
--- src/mod/applications/mod_avmd/avmd_fast_acosf.c.orig	2016-05-05 20:42:20 UTC
2
+++ src/mod/applications/mod_avmd/avmd_fast_acosf.c
3
@@ -23,6 +23,9 @@
4
 #include "avmd_fast_acosf.h"
5
 #include "avmd_options.h"
6
7
+#ifndef MAP_POPULATE
8
+#define MAP_POPULATE 0
9
+#endif
10
11
 typedef union {
12
     uint32_t i;
(-)net/freeswitch/pkg-plist (+3 lines)
Lines 24-29 Link Here
24
include/freeswitch/switch_cpp.h
24
include/freeswitch/switch_cpp.h
25
include/freeswitch/switch_curl.h
25
include/freeswitch/switch_curl.h
26
include/freeswitch/switch_dso.h
26
include/freeswitch/switch_dso.h
27
include/freeswitch/switch_estimators.h
27
include/freeswitch/switch_event.h
28
include/freeswitch/switch_event.h
28
include/freeswitch/switch_frame.h
29
include/freeswitch/switch_frame.h
29
include/freeswitch/switch_hashtable.h
30
include/freeswitch/switch_hashtable.h
Lines 632-637 Link Here
632
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/acl.conf.xml
633
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/acl.conf.xml
633
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/alsa.conf.xml
634
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/alsa.conf.xml
634
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/amqp.conf.xml
635
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/amqp.conf.xml
636
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/avmd.conf.xml
635
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/blacklist.conf.xml
637
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/blacklist.conf.xml
636
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/callcenter.conf.xml
638
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/callcenter.conf.xml
637
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/cdr_csv.conf.xml
639
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/cdr_csv.conf.xml
Lines 689-694 Link Here
689
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/shout.conf.xml
691
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/shout.conf.xml
690
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/skinny.conf.xml
692
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/skinny.conf.xml
691
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/smpp.conf.xml
693
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/smpp.conf.xml
694
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/sms_flowroute.conf.xml
692
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/sofia.conf.xml
695
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/sofia.conf.xml
693
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/spandsp.conf.xml
696
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/spandsp.conf.xml
694
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/switch.conf.xml
697
%%PORTEXAMPLES%%%%EXAMPLESDIR%%/vanilla/autoload_configs/switch.conf.xml

Return to bug 215063